“On April 29, a branch of the border department of the FSB of Russia in the Bryansk region was subjected to mortar fire from the territory of Ukraine in the village of Belaya Beryozka, Trubchevsky district,” he wrote on Telegram.

As a result of the shelling, no one was injured, the water and electricity networks were damaged.

Earlier, the governor of the Kursk region, Roman Starovoit, announced the shelling of the village of Krupets from mortars.
